- Lean Startup taught the world how to find product/market fit, but in the B2B world that isn’t enough. B2B founders must then find a way to build repeatable, scalable and profitable growth before they are ready to step on the accelerator and grow at high speed. In this talk, five-time serial entrepreneur and author of the ForEntrepreneurs blog, David Skok, breaks this journey down into 9 distinct stages and explains the playbook at each stage. Warning: trying to force growth by skipping a step is the number one mistake entrepreneurs make, and it is often fatal.

I just wanna note something most of people in business kinda miss: linearly growing bookings (as the bar chart suggests) lead to a quadratic growth in ARR not exponential.
Exponential is a shiny word, but let’s not use it loosely. 10:32
Exponential growth in ARR happens if you have exponential growth in bookings too. This can happen if your product is so good that each customer is referring 2+ other customers as well.
